how to do flower decoration for indian wedding?
Flower decoration is an essential part of Indian weddings. Here are some tips for doing flower decoration for an Indian wedding:
1. Choose the right flowers: Marigold, roses, jasmine, and orchids are some of the popular flowers used in Indian weddings. Choose flowers that match the wedding theme and color scheme.
2. Create a flower mandap: A flower mandap is a canopy-like structure where the wedding ceremony takes place. Use flowers to decorate the mandap and create a beautiful backdrop for the wedding.
3. Use flowers for centerpieces: Use flowers to create beautiful centerpieces for the tables. You can use a mix of flowers and candles to create a romantic ambiance.
4. Create a flower pathway: Use flowers to create a beautiful pathway for the bride and groom to walk down. You can use flower petals or create a flower archway.
5. Use flowers for garlands: Garlands are an important part of Indian weddings. Use flowers to create beautiful garlands for the bride and groom.
Remember to choose flowers that are in season and easily available. With a little creativity, you can create a beautiful flower decoration for an Indian wedding.

3、 Color schemes and flower combinations
How to do flower decoration for Indian wedding? One of the most important aspects of flower decoration for an Indian wedding is the color scheme and flower combinations. The color scheme should be chosen based on the theme of the wedding and the preferences of the bride and groom. Some popular color schemes for Indian weddings include red and gold, pink and white, and purple and green.
When it comes to flower combinations, it is important to choose flowers that are in season and readily available. Some popular flowers for Indian weddings include roses, marigolds, orchids, and jasmine. These flowers can be used in a variety of ways, such as in garlands, centerpieces, and bouquets.
In recent years, there has been a trend towards using more exotic and unique flowers in Indian wedding decorations. Some popular choices include peonies, dahlias, and ranunculus. These flowers can add a modern and sophisticated touch to traditional Indian wedding decor.
Another trend in Indian wedding flower decoration is the use of floral installations, such as hanging floral chandeliers and flower walls. These installations can create a stunning backdrop for the wedding ceremony or reception.
Overall, when it comes to flower decoration for an Indian wedding, it is important to choose a color scheme and flower combinations that reflect the couple's style and preferences. With the right flowers and decor, an Indian wedding can be a truly magical and unforgettable event.
